What is cloud command in AutoCAD?

Creating and modifying AutoCAD Revision Clouds. Revision clouds are geometries used in AutoCAD to drive attention of users to a certain part of the drawing. The revision clouds are Polylines in the shape of connected arcs and they can also be modified like a Polyline.

What is a revision cloud?

Revision clouds are closed polylines that form cloud-shaped objects consisting of arc segments. If you review or markup drawings, you can use the revision cloud feature to call attention to portions of each drawing.

How do I use a revision cloud in Autocad?

Convert an Object to a Revision Cloud

  1. Click Home tab Draw panel Revision Cloud drop-down. Find.
  2. In the drawing area, right-click and choose Object.
  3. Select a circle, ellipse, polyline, or spline that you want to convert to a revision cloud.
  4. Press Enter to keep the current direction of the arcs. …
  5. Press Enter.

How do I change the Revcloud arc length in AutoCAD 2021?

In the drawing area, right-click and choose the Arc length option. Enter a new approximate chord length for the revision cloud arcs. Continue the REVCLOUD command or press Esc to accept the new value and exit the command.
